When it comes to kitchen remodeling, many homeowners are looking for ways to make their space more eco-friendly. One aspect of this is choosing the right paint colors for kitchen cabinets. Opting for non-toxic, low-VOC paints can help reduce harmful emissions in your home. Some popular eco-friendly paint colors for cabinets include shades of green, blue, and gray.

When it comes to kitchen design trends, homeowners are often torn between modern and traditional styles. Modern kitchens typically feature sleek lines and minimalist design, while traditional kitchens embrace classic elements like ornate cabinetry and intricate details. Consider your personal style and the overall aesthetic of your home when deciding on a design direction.
Another popular trend in kitchen remodeling is the open concept layout. While this can create a more spacious and airy feel, it's important to consider the pros and cons. Open concept kitchens are great for entertaining and family gatherings, but they can also lead to less privacy and more noise. Think about how you use your kitchen space before making a decision.

When it comes to modern vs. traditional kitchen designs, the choice of countertops can play a significant role in defining the overall style. Sleek and minimalist quartz countertops are popular in modern kitchens, while traditional designs may feature classic materials like granite or marble.
